2020-21:
CoSIDA Academic All-District®…United Soccer Coaches Scholar All-Region Second Team…All-CAA Second Team…Appeared in all nine matches and made eight starts…Recorded four goals which tied for third on the team and finished tied for fifth in the CAA…Also added two assists…Tallied 10 total points which was sixth in the conference…Scored two goals in Hofstra’s 4-0 victory over UAlbany on 3/3 for the first multi-goal effort of her career…Led the CAA with three game-winning goals (vs. Fairleigh Dickinson on 2/25, vs. UAlbany on 3/3 and vs. Towson on 4/10)…Fired at least one shot in all nine contests including a season-high of six in the CAA semifinal vs. Elon on 4/15.
2019:
United Soccer Coaches Scholar All-East Region Third Team…All-CAA Second Team…Started and played in all 22 matches for the Pride, logging 1,648 minutes on the pitch…Tallied 21 points which ranked fourth on the team…Recorded six goals and nine assists…Her nine assists finished tied for second on the team, tied for fourth in the CAA and tied for the fifth-highest amount in program history…Her assist total tied for sixth in program history in a single-season…Assisted on six game-winning goals…Recorded two assists in a 2-1 double overtime win at Stony Brook (9/8)…Tallied three points (1 goal, 1 assist) in a 3-2 win at Delaware (10/13)…Scored one goal in the CAA Championship match vs. James Madison (11/9)…Scored the game-winning goal in the 74th minute in a 1-0 win over Columbia (9/15)…Named the CAA Offensive Player of the Week for the week of 10/7…Named to the Dean’s List, Hofstra Athletic Director Scholars Academic Honor Roll, and CAA Commissioner’s Academic Honor Roll following the Fall 2019 and spring 2020 semesters.
2018:
Played in 23 games while making 11 total starts…Logged 952 minutes on the pitch…Tallied four goals which finished third on the team…Also recorded one assist (vs. UNCW, 9/30) for a total of nine points which tied for fourth on the team…Took 21 total shots including eight on goal…Scored the game-winning goal in double overtime (105:39) against Fairleigh Dickinson (9/6)..Recorded one goal in a 4-1 rout of No. 22 Boston College in the second round of the NCAA tournament (11/9)…Played a season-high 75 minutes at Princeton (9/9)…Named to the CAA Spring Commissioner’s Academic Honor Roll…Also participated in Hofstra’s inaugural track and field season.

High School:
Spent eight years with Aston Villa Laides, serving two seasons on the First Team…Helped lead Aston Villa U17 to FA Youth Cup Final in 2013-14, where she became the first-ever Aston Villa player to score in an FA Youth Cup Final…Made first First-Team start in a match against Brescia, a team that featured seven Italian internationals…Has played internationally for English School Girls and England U19…Helped the England U19 team win the UEFA Coefficient Tournament, scoring her first international goal against Northern Ireland…Named district sports personality of the year
